Creme De Menthe Parfait

Layered parfait with a homemade creme de menthe pineapple sauce spooned over scoops of vanilla ice cream. A retro dessert that comes together in 15 minutes.

This is the kind of throwback dessert that deserves a comeback.

Crushed pineapple gets simmered with sugar and corn syrup until glossy and translucent, then spiked with creme de menthe for a cool, minty kick.

Layer that bright green sauce with vanilla ice cream in tall glasses, and you’ve got a showstopper that takes all of 15 minutes to pull together.

It’s retro, it’s fun, and it tastes like a tropical mint dream.

Kitchen Tips

  • Let the sauce cool completely before layering, or it will melt the ice cream into soup
  • Use green creme de menthe for the classic parfait color contrast
  • Swap vanilla for chocolate ice cream to turn this into a grasshopper-style parfait

Directions

Boil all ingredients except Creme de Menthe and ice cream.

When pineapple is clear, add Creme de Menthe.

Let cool and make parfaits in the usual manner, alternating sauce and ice cream.
